Vuforia engine can also be accessed through the unity package manager by adding vuforia s package repository with the script below. Vuforia in ftc part 2 scanning and tracking objects. If not, try making one object a child of the other, so you can check the distance using the localposition value of the child object like this. Getting started with vuforia model target problems and. My database shows up in vuforia engine configuration. Toys and consumer products often make good object targets. Vuforia unity 2018 augmented reality projects book. Vuforia is able to recognise and process 3d objects as targets for ar content creation. At present, the main limitation to this ar content creation is the need to use vuforia s proprietary scanning software, vuforia object scanner, to create an object target. Object targets are a digital representation of the features and geometry of a physical object. I try to implement the application on a nexus 7 android version 4. Vuforia is an image analysis library, managed by ptc, that can track objects seen by the phones camera. You can add vuforia engine targets to your scene by selecting the associated game objects in the gameobject vuforia menu.
Use vuforia engine to build augmented reality android, ios, and uwp applications for mobile devices and ar glasses. Tips and tricks for augmented reality with unity and vuforia. Download vuforia sdk accessible, crossplatform and powerful development package the enables developers to create visionbased augmented reality programs. Hololens, unity and recognition with vuforia part 2. Extracting the sdk will create a directory structure for your android development environment. Were excited to announce availability of vuforia 4. Hello, i was planning on following the steps in the vuforia object scanner users guide in order to import a 3d object target into a database in vuforia. Getting started with vuforia for windows 10 development. This video shows the test mode in vuforia object scanner included in qualcomm vuforia sdk 4. I attached a script to the gameobject and initialized it defaulttrackableeventhandler script. I am trying to implement the vuforia object recognition unity sample. Mar 18, 2020 download vuforia sdk accessible, crossplatform and powerful development package the enables developers to create visionbased augmented reality programs. Is there any system that can with a static camera position it, and with a camera phone to navigate close to the object. Once youve created a device database containing your object targets, you can.
Get started developing ar apps with unity and vuforia. After scanning, you upload your object data file to the vuforia target. Upload the file to the vuforia target manager online. Daram also appears a good sdk for android, ios, windows 8 and mac. I have to admit a very large object in vuforia, having the ability to get close and not lose recognition. Apps can be built with unity, android studio, xcode, and visual studio.
The vuforia object scanner is an android application used to scan a physical. Jan 16, 2018 vuforia 7 3d object scanner tutorial in unity 2017 hey guys and welcome back, today we are going to be augmenting objects in the real world as opposed to just scanning markers and overlaying. Building process went fine and the app works, but no tracking is perceptible. Extract the contents of the sdk zip archive, placing it in your android development root folder. Dec 20, 2014 this video shows how to use vuforia object scanner included in qualcomm vuforia sdk 4. Feb 12, 2016 were excited to announce availability of vuforia 4. Extended tracking doesnt work with object target unity forum. In this section, you will learn about the vuforia 7 3d object scanner this website uses cookies to ensure you get the best experience on our website. The app can only be installed by download on this link. Od file that includes the source data required to define an object target in the target manager. If you would like to use your own objects, you can create an object target database using the vuforia object scanner. Wikitudes architect sdk has an vuforia extension and blackberry 10 support. Turn complex objects into targets with the vuforia engine object scanner.
This article explains how to start developing for windows 10 with vuforia engine in both unity and visual studio. Multi targets demonstrates use of targets formed by several planar targets, in this case forming a box. Vuforia engine cloud recognition service allows your vuforia engineenabled application to recognize image targets through a cloud database, giving you the ability to update targets dynamically, integrate with your existing cms, and manage more than one million image targets for a single app. This is because the way you have set the world center mode in vuforia. An object to be detected must have the same shape as the scanned reference object. Cylinder targets demonstrates cylindrical objects usage, along with the occlusion effect on a soda can shaped object. Object scanning and detection is optimized for objects small enough to fit on a tabletop. The vuforia object scanner is an android application used to scan a physical 3d object. The camera render on screen but on the same image target not display cube in 3d. Get started developing ar apps with unity and vuforia unity. If vuforia can track objects using the pointdata generated from vuforia object scanner, than what i requested definitely can work. Augmented reality game development with unity and vuforia. Extended tracking doesnt work with object target unity.
Simply install the app, place an object on the vuforia scanning target, and start the scan. Vuforia provides the fastest, easiest and most advanced ar content development solutions to help industrial enterprise customers address workforce. Wikitudes architect sdk has an vuforiaextension and blackberry 10 support. Ive got one thats a cloud db but its only allows target images. Scanning target is included in the vuforia object scanner download package. Vuforia 7 3d object scanner the internet of things using. Experimenting with vuforia object recognition on android. Vuforia engine is a software platform for creating augmented reality apps. How to use the vuforia object recognition unity sample. The device db allows a 3d object but only ones uploaded by the vuforia object scanner. Feb 10, 2016 vuforia developer library integrating cardboard to the arvr sample. The layar sdk is now available for ios and android with 3d, animation, ar video and qrcode scanner.
Our wideranging solution suite ensures that we can provide the right ar technology to every customer based on their business needs. Unfortunately the lack of autofocus is making it impossible for us to update to vuforia 7 for our ios app. The vuforia object scanner is an android application for 3d scanning. Vuforia is a comprehensive, scalable enterprise ar platform. Vuforia 7 3d object scanner tutorial in unity 2017 youtube. The vuforia engine cloud recognition service leverages the power of the cloud to give you flexibility and scale. At present, the main limitation to this ar content creation is the need to use vuforias proprietary scanning software, vuforia object scanner, to create an object target. Dec 20, 2014 this video shows the test mode in vuforia object scanner included in qualcomm vuforia sdk 4. An object target works in a similar way to imagebased 2d targets but utilises a feature scan as its target source. It contains information on installing unity, activating vuforia engine within your project, and accessing vuforia engine features.
Oct 27, 2017 after registering on vuforia developer portal, you have access to resources provided by the platform. I have generated an object using the object vuforia object scanner android app, uploaded it to a target library, and downloaded it as a unity package then installed it. This video shows how to use vuforia object scanner included in. Getting started with vuforia for android development. There are many factors that can affect the tracking performance of a object target, both during the scanning process and when running an app. Dec 08, 2016 add the possibility to track an object from a custom pointset given by me, created in a 3d modeling tool like blender of 3dmax, instead of lets say from that limiting app called vuforia object scanner. Vuforia engine supports the development of universal windows platform uwp apps on select intelbased windows 10 devices, including microsoft surface and hololens.
This structure ensures that vuforia engine sample apps can easily be built and deployed using the android sdk, android ndk, and the android studio development environment. The vuforia object scanner available for android helps you easily scan 3d objects into a target format that is compatible with the vuforia engine. Object targets are the best choice for 3d objects that have a stable geometry and few moving parts. Before proceeding, familiarize yourself with the contents of the getting started with vuforia engine for unity development article. Vuforia 7 3d object scanner tutorial in unity 2017 hey guys and welcome back, today we are going to be augmenting objects in the real world as opposed to just scanning markers and overlaying. You can now download the database and use it in your application. Virtual reality sdk integration support below is a list of vr sdks fully integrated into the unity editor, along with the release version of the editor where they were first integrated. An object target is created by scanning a physical object using vuforia object scanner.
Also, using the vuforia object scanner, you can scan and create object targets. Most issues with object targets can be traced to the creation of the. Add the possibility to track an object from a custom pointset given by me, created in a 3d modeling tool like blender of 3dmax, instead of lets say from that limiting app called vuforia object scanner. When arcamera detects the image and starts the augmentation, i want to show my gameobject. Either import the unitypackage from asset import package in the unity editor, or by double clicking the package file on your file system. Object recognition demonstrates tracking of targets created with the vuforia object scanner application. This video shows how to use vuforia object scanner included in qualcomm vuforia sdk 4.
Download and run the unity download assistant 2018. Multi targets demonstrates use of targets formed by. A vumark is created using adobe illustrator and the vumark design tools that are available for download on vuforias site. For more detailed information on these tools see the vuforia calibration assistant and object scanner pages in the vuforia developer library. Vuforia is able to do many different things, such as recognition of different types of visual objects such as boxes, cylinders, and planes, text and environment recognition, and vumark, which is a combination of picture and qr code. Vuforia developer library integrating cardboard to the arvr sample. A target game object will be added in your scene hierarchy, which will be visible in. Vuforia ar platform unity augmented reality development. Render 3d object cube with image target from unity3d. You can use the unity distance function and it should work fine. Rigid objects work better for detection than soft bodies or items that bend, twist, fold, or otherwise change shape. Jul 23, 2019 the last thing you need to do is import vuforia. Vuforia engine can also be accessed through the unity package manager by adding vuforias package repository with the script below. So im assuming i dont need either of these databases.
Create a device database in the target manager that includes the object target that you want to use. Hololens, unity and recognition with vuforia part 1 i wanted to see if i could do some type of custom object recognition using hololens and vuforia starting from scratch rather than starting from the prebaked vuforia sample and following the steps. The vuforia object scanner allows you to create a target by scanning an object with an android device. I have successfully imported image targets and had no issue. The app gives you realtime visual feedback on the scan progress and target quality and establishes a coordinate system so that you can build immersive. Developers can easily add advanced computer vision functionality to any application, allowing it to recognize images and objects, and interact with spaces in the real world.
107 1344 591 671 1293 1507 186 1118 1360 928 835 607 434 782 1417 1204 1424 867 980 1434 869 1151 826 963 1107 296 648 467 694 1430